I'm sure by now you may know I'm a huge 5 lug swap fan and now that I've owned 4 foxbody's with my 4th one being my current hatch and the only one I've 5 lug swapped I have to say that it's hand down the best mod I've ever done and it's the most functional too. It may seem like a lot of work and a big expense but it's a huge improvement. I always thought people exaggerated the benefits of it but it's true, night and day difference. I say all of this because you may get caught up with adding HP first but IMO first upgrades should always be Maximum Motorsports full length SFC's, 5 lug Cobra swap front and rear, torque box reinforcements, gears, etc..

A note on the exhaust, go to a muffler shop, after getting some recommendations, and have them adjust what you got on there, a good shop can weld in some flanges between the cat pipes and the mid pipes then adjust it so they don't rub anything. That can save some money.
On another note, power can be had without sacrificing the emission equipment. To a point.
This is a complete mostly unmolested fox, they are getting hard to find, any factory equipment you remove I hope you store for future use.

A5literMan said:
Don't go above 3.55's if you're going to boost it. Nice car and looks like a good buy. Congrats.
Click to expand...
How come?

QuietOne said:
How come?
Click to expand...
You will make better use of the powerband. The motor will like it much better instead of blowing through. It will rev easier/quicker and you want the motor to "pull" you instead of being "pushed" to redline(if that makes sense). 4.10's are great for a n/a combo but not with the blower. Unless you build some motor that will spin 7-8k that is.
